How Our Floor Water Damage Restoration Service Works

Our team follows a meticulous process to ensure your floors are restored to their original state. A proper process matters, and corners can’t be cut with preventing mold growth and preserving structural integrity.

Step 1: Assessment and Planning

Our technicians will arrive within 60 minutes to assess the damage and create a personalized plan to restore your floors. We use specialized equipment to measure moisture levels and identify any underlying issues.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We’ll use heavy-duty pumps and vacuums to extract the standing water from your floors. This step is critical in preventing further damage and reducing drying time.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

We’ll employ advanced drying techniques and specialized equipment to remove excess moisture from your floors and walls. This process can take up to 3-5 days depending on the severity of the damage.

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fecting

Our technicians will thoroughly clean and disinfect your floors to prevent the growth of mold and mildew. We use eco-friendly products that are safe for your family and pets.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Touch-ups

We’ll conduct a final inspection to ensure your floors are dry and free of any signs of damage. We’ll make any necessary touch-ups to ensure your home is restored to its original state.

Warning Signs You Need Floor Water Damage Restoration

Catching these signs early can save you thousands and prevent bigger problems. Don’t ignore the warning signs and risk further damage to your home.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home, it’s a sign of mold growth and needs immediate attention.

Warped or Buckled Floors

If your floors are warping or buckling, it’s a sign of water damage and needs professional restoration.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

If your paint or wallpaper is peeling, it’s a sign of moisture issues and needs immediate attention.

Visible Water Stains

If you notice visible water stains on your ceiling or walls, it’s a sign of a larger issue and needs professional restoration.

Unusual Sounds or Creaks

If you notice unusual sounds or creaks in your home, it’s a sign of structural damage and needs immediate attention.

Visible Mold or Mildew

If you notice visible mold or mildew on your walls or floors, it’s a sign of a serious issue and needs professional restoration.

Floor Water Damage Restoration Cost In Cameron, MO

The cost of floor water damage restoration can vary greatly dep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Prices can range from $500 to $2,500 or more, depending on the extent of the damage.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ction $500 – $2,000 The size of the affected area and the amount of water extracted
Drying and d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 The severity of the damage and the amount of time required to dry the area
Cleaning and disinfecting $500 – $2,000 The extent of the mold or mildew growth
Final inspection and touch-ups $500 – $1,000 The number of touch-ups required to ensure the area is restored to its original state
Emergency service fee $200 – $500 The time of day and day of the week
